Started the schurzen plates today , after a bit swearing (again) Ive nearly done them . The plastic I used may be a bit to thick ? Ive heated each panel up and put in some bends etc . The mounting brackets I made from steel shim plate easy to bend and cut . I realised on some of the pictures of the end sections I have the mounting brackets wrong . Ive re done this now so they run with the end angle . The front section I have left until I put it all onto the tank.

Had a go at fixing the schurzen today . The idea was for it all to be removable ,with mixed results . Its not quiet how I want it but getting there . I agree with you Mart regarding the pining of the mounting brackets to the tank. Theres a lot there for just glue to hold .Ive still got some alterations to make the two brackets in the middle need altering , the outside two need a bit of adjustment . And Ive got to adjust a couple of hangers .  :-\ Oh and the two outside sections need angles cutting of them . I also need to make some more mounting brackets for the front section.
